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ow
Updated: August 22, 2023Located in the Mojave Desert, east of Barstow, the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ow is a pivotal supply and maintenance hub for the U.S. Marine Corps. It specializes in repairing and rebuilding ground combat and combat-support equipment, primarily serving West Coast installations.

What Kind of Base is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ow?
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ow is a strategic hub due to its proximity to three major highways and location within 150 miles of the major ports in Los Angeles and San Diego. The base features three main sites: Nebo Annex, Yermo Annex, and a site dedicated to rifle and pistol ranges. One of the base’s standout features is the Marine Corps Logistics Bases’ Maintenance Center, one of only two in the U.S. Additionally, the base boasts the only horse-mounted color guard in the Marine Corps.
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ow History
Established on December 28, 1942, as the Marine Corps Depot of Supplies, the base initially stored supplies for Fleet Marine Forces during WWII. Its role expanded in March 1961 with the inception of the Depot Maintenance Activity. Renamed the Marine Corps Logistics Base in November 1978, it now serves as an essential part of the logistics chain that arms and equips the Marine forces
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ow Housing
The base provides 74 government family quarters in Desert View and Quarters Street. Newcomers should visit the family housing office, located in Building 363, upon arrival. For housing inquiries, contact: 760-577-6872.
Off-base housing is available in the surrounding areas of Barstow, California.

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ow Surrounding Area
Marine Corps Logistics Base Barstow sits at the intersection of I-15, I-40, and SR 58. Close by is Barstow, with a population of roughly 25,000, and other towns like Victorville, Apple Valley, and Hesperia. Notable attractions include Mojave National Preserve, Death Valley, Joshua Tree, the Grand Canyon, and a segment of the original U.S. Route 66 running through the base.
Healthcare
The Weed Army Community Hospital at Fort Irwin is the primary on-post medical facility. While it offers numerous services, some patients may need to go off base for specialized or emergency care.
Childcare
The base’s Child Development Centers (CDCs) cater to diverse needs, with two centers operating on different schedules. Parents can consider the Family Child Care/Child Development Homes for a homelier setting.

Schooling
MCLB Barstow lacks DoD schools. Kids on base attend Barstow Unified School District (BUSD) institutions. Reach out to the School Liaison Officer at 760-577-5854 for details on nearby school districts.
